20th June 2023, Mumbai: In his latest Hollywood movie, ‘Kandahar,’ Ali Fazal embraced a new adventure—learning the art of dirt biking. While the sport is still relatively uncommon in India, Ali, portraying the character of Kahil, dedicated time during the shoot to acquire the necessary skills for his role. As a war thriller, this film marks Ali’s first venture into the realm of high-octane action. Extensively filmed in Saudi Arabia’s Al Ula region, ‘Kandahar’ showcases Ali’s commitment to delivering an authentic and thrilling performance.
For Ali, dirt biking has become a beloved passion and a welcomed break from regular city biking. However, he humbly acknowledges that perfection is a constant pursuit. Working with an exceptional stunt team on a meticulously measured and state-of-the-art production like ‘Kandahar,’ Ali deliberately chose a simple and affordable bike, such as a KTM, over more glamorous options like Ducati or Hayabusa. The choice was driven by the need to perform genuine stunts in the desert, where faking the adrenaline-charged scenes was not an option. To master the art, Ali arrived 25 days before the shoot, immersing himself in learning various riding techniques, from riding on sand to executing different skids, breaks, and turns. Beyond the stunts, Ali believes in the power of body language and captivating the audience, as he shares a profound camaraderie with his stunt double, tackling daring shots on treacherous cliffs.
‘Kandahar’ features an ensemble of acclaimed international actors, including Gerard Butler, Travis Fimmel, and Navid Negahban. Following its release in North American theaters, the film is now available for streaming on Amazon Prime Video. In this action-packed thriller, Ali portrays Kahil, one of the main antagonists, showcasing his versatility and dedication as an actor.
